1. Artistic Value

The power of Golden Path lies in its compositional guidance and symbolic color. The artist employs linear perspective, with the avenue drawing the eye into the horizon, creating depth and immersion.

Gold dominates the palette, shimmering with layered textures. It represents not only autumn’s abundance but also prosperity, honor, and hope. Historically, gold has been linked with sacredness and nobility in both Eastern and Western art. Here, however, it carries a more intimate meaning—warmth and reassurance in everyday life.

Technically, the painting leans toward abstraction rather than realism. The foliage is rendered with textured strokes rather than precise detail, transforming a seasonal scene into an emotional experience.
